The upcoming artbook for The Fantastic Four: First Steps has had another update that comes with positive news for fans. The previous information left a lot to be desired, but now there is a reason for the change, as it comes with a second book.
Marvel Studios' The Fantastic Four: First Steps - The Art of the Movie is currently due on November 18th and is listed for $150. You might be thinking that's a lot of money, because it is, much more than most collector's editions of artbooks. It was a major concern that I spoke about in my previous reporting, as the listings took it from 400 pages to 256 while maintaining that high price point, you can read that story here. Now though, it looks like the justification for the second price hike in the space of year is to add an addition book to the slipcase, Marvel Studios' The Fantastic Four: First Steps Portfolio.

Like the last update, the information has been confirmed on the same websites including Amazon, Target and Barnes & Noble. Listings in other regions are not all available, with some, like Amazon in the UK, having it as unavailable and not yet up for pre-order.
It's not clear what this new portfolio book actually includes, as it is described as the following; "MARVEL STUDIOS’ THE FANTASTIC FOUR: FIRST STEPS PORTFOLIO HC includes a stunning gallery of never-before-seen artwork." This is what you expect from all Marvel Studios' artbooks, so the distinction between the two isn't yet apparent. At the very least it does explain the high price point, as for a good while it looked like another increase for just an extra 32 pages. It may also be the case that the original information that stated there would be 400 pages is correct after all.
The last price increase was to add the slipcase and lithographs, which started with Marvel Studios' Deadpool & Wolverine: The Art of the Movie in October of last year. This will continue with the artbooks for Agatha All Along, Captain America: Brave New World and Thunderbolts*. I pointed out in my review of the book for Deadpool & Wolverine that the price felt too high for the extras, but an additional book certainly makes another increase easier to justify.
It will be interesting to see if this will be implemented again going forward. If I had to speculate, I would say it is much more likely for the movies, especially Avengers: Doomsday and Secret Wars given the large cast and scope. As much as there is a lot of excitement around the return of Marvel's first family, it would be odd if only The Fantastic Four: First Steps got the double book treatment.
There is also the upcoming artbook for Daredevil: Born Again that was confirmed by artist Jackson Sze, there are no listings yet, but when there are it will be an indication of whether the TV projects will get the additional portfolio book as well.
It's good to be able to report some positive news for the Marvel Studios' artbooks following multiple delays, as they have always been very good when they do finally hit store shelves. It must be acknowledged though that this might not be the best news for some, because the economy is tough for a lot of people. The series going from $60, to $100, and now $150, is an expense that may cause many to pass on this entry in the long running series. At the very least, for fans that can spare the money, they can now see the increased value for that price tag.
